The so-called lithium battery is the general name of the battery with metal lithium as the negative electrode active material, and the lithium battery refers to the secondary battery system in which two different lithium intercalation compounds that can reversibly insert and deintercalate lithium ions are used as the positive and negative electrodes of the battery. The similarity between lithium batteries and lithium batteries is the positive electrode and electrolyte. Both batteries use metal oxides and sulfides as the positive electrode, and organic solvent-inorganic salt system as the electrolyte. There is a development process between lithium battery and lithium battery. Lithium battery is a kind of material that uses lithium metal or lithium alloy as negative electrode material. The chemical reaction is redox reaction. Later, Sony company invented carbon material as negative electrode. Lithium-containing compounds are used as the positive electrode of the lithium battery. During the charge and discharge process, there is no metal lithium, only lithium ions, which is a lithium battery. Strictly speaking, the working mechanism of lithium batteries and lithium batteries is different. Lithium batteries are primary batteries, also known as lithium primary batteries, which can continue to be discharged or intermittently discharged. Some lithium batteries can be used as batteries for storage facilities, such as Use in water power, wind power, solar power plants, etc. The lithium battery is a secondary battery that can be used repeatedly. Nowadays, many people are used to calling lithium batteries also called lithium batteries, which is a convenient name. From the perspective of use, lithium batteries and lithium batteries in the strict sense are also different. Lithium batteries use metallic lithium for the negative electrode, MnO2, SOCl2 for the positive electrode, etc. After they were put into practical use in the 1970s, they were urgently used in some small military and civilian electrical appliances. Lithium batteries are more widely used, such as mobile phones, camcorders, cameras, laptop computers, etc. The use of large-capacity lithium batteries in electric vehicles has also entered the process of industrialization. From the perspective of the development trend of lithium batteries and lithium batteries, the use of lithium batteries continues to expand, while the use of lithium primary batteries continues to shrink. Lithium batteries and lithium batteries may be confused in practice, but there is a fundamental difference between them: there is no lithium metal during the reaction of lithium batteries, only the movement of lithium ions between the positive and negative electrodes. Therefore, it is also called the rocking chair type. Batteries, people can respect the habitual name of lithium batteries and lithium batteries in life, but this does not hinder people from understanding the theoretical differences between the two.
